Slow Cooker Mediterranean Chicken Ingredients
-
For the Chicken
• Chicken Thighs – 1.5 lbs of juicy meat that stays tender in the slow cooker; chicken breasts can be used but watch for dryness. -
For the Aromatics
• Olive Oil – Adds richness and prevents sticking; any vegetable oil can be used as a substitute.
• Onions (1 cup, sliced) – Provides sweetness and depth; shallots can work in a pinch.
• Garlic (2 tablespoons, minced) – Elevates the flavor profile; granulated garlic can be a quick alternative. -
For the Veggies
• Bell Peppers (2, sliced) – They contribute sweetness and color; feel free to mix colors for visual appeal.
• Diced Tomatoes (1 can, 14 oz) – Brings moisture and acidity; fresh chopped tomatoes can be used instead. -
For the Flavor
• Dried Oregano (1 tablespoon) – Essential for a robust Mediterranean flavor; fresh oregano will work if you increase the quantity.
• Dried Thyme (1 teaspoon) – Adds a lovely herbaceous note.
• Dried Rosemary (1 teaspoon) – Complements the other herbs; fresh rosemary can be substituted if you use more.
• Red Pepper Flakes (1/2 teaspoon) – Offers a hint of heat; feel free to omit for a milder dish. -
For the Briny Touch
• Kalamata Olives (1/4 cup, pitted) – Introduces a salty, briny flavor; green olives can be a great alternative. -
For the Broth
• Chicken Broth (1/2 cup) – Adds depth to the dish while keeping it moist; vegetable broth can be used for a vegan version. -
For the Finish
• Lemon Juice (1/4 cup) – Brightens the overall flavor; vinegar can serve as a suitable substitute.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Slow Cooker Mediterranean Chicken
Step 1: Prep Ingredients
Begin by slicing the onions, garlic, and bell peppers, setting them aside for easy layering. Season the chicken thighs liberally with salt and pepper to enhance their flavor. This crucial step sets the groundwork for a delicious Slow Cooker Mediterranean Chicken, ensuring every bite is brimming with taste.
Step 2: Layer Slow Cooker
Pour olive oil into the bottom of your slow cooker to prevent sticking and add richness. Then, add half of the sliced onions, minced garlic, and bell peppers as a flavorful base. The colorful vegetables create a visually appealing foundation for your Mediterranean chicken, making it even more enticing.
Step 3: Season Chicken
Place the seasoned chicken thighs over the vegetable layer, ensuring they are evenly distributed. Sprinkle dried oregano, thyme, rosemary, and red pepper flakes over the chicken. This blend of herbs will infuse the dish with aromatic Mediterranean flavors as it cooks, creating that mouthwatering taste you’ll adore.
Step 4: Add Remaining Ingredients
Layer the remaining sliced onions, bell peppers, Kalamata olives, and diced tomatoes over the chicken thighs, creating a vibrant topping. Pour in the chicken broth and lemon juice to add moisture and a tangy zing. This combination presents a stunning visual while ensuring the chicken stays juicy throughout the cooking process.
Step 5: Cook
Cover your slow cooker and set it to cook on low for 7-8 hours or high for 4 hours. The chicken is done when it’s fork-tender and easily pulls apart. During this time, the Slow Cooker Mediterranean Chicken will soak up all the delicious flavors from the vegetables and spices.
Step 6: Finishing Touches
Once cooked, gently stir the contents of the slow cooker to blend the flavors. If the chicken seems dry, add a splash more broth for moisture. Serve your Slow Cooker Mediterranean Chicken garnished with fresh parsley, lemon slices, and crumbled feta cheese, if desired, to elevate this delightful dish further.

Slow Cooker Mediterranean Chicken Variations
Feel free to explore and customize this recipe to suit your taste buds and dietary needs!
-
Bone-In Thighs: Substitute with bone-in chicken thighs for extra flavor; just increase cooking time by 30-45 minutes for perfect tenderness.
-
Veggie Boost: Add diced zucchini or eggplant for added nutrition and texture; they soak up those fabulous flavors beautifully.
-
Kid-Friendly: Reduce or omit red pepper flakes for a milder taste and serve the chicken shredded over pasta for a loved-up family meal.
-
Grain Base: Serve the chicken over a comforting bed of quinoa or brown rice; it’ll soak up the delicious juices and add a whole grain twist.
-
Mediterranean Twist: For an even more authentic taste, add capers and sun-dried tomatoes, bringing a delightful burst of flavor to every bite.
-
Fresh Herbs: Stir in fresh basil or parsley just before serving to brighten up the dish; the freshness will be a lively complement to the rich flavors.
-
Spice it Up: If you enjoy a spicy kick, raise the amount of red pepper flakes, or add a splash of your favorite hot sauce; this will elevate the dish even more.
-
Plant-Based: For a vegan option, replace the chicken with hearty chickpeas and use vegetable broth for a satisfying, nutritious meal that everyone will enjoy.

Storage Tips for Slow Cooker Mediterranean Chicken
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 4 days. This dish actually improves in flavor as it sits, so it’s perfect for meal prep!
Freezer: Freeze in a sealed container for up to 3 months. For best results, divide into meal-sized portions before freezing.
Reheating: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ating. Heat gently on the stove or in the microwave until warmed through, adding a splash of chicken broth if needed to retain moisture.

Make Ahead Options
These Slow Cooker Mediterranean Chicken preparations are perfect for busy home cooks looking to save time! You can chop the vegetables and season the chicken up to 24 hours in advance; simply refrigerate them in an airtight container to maintain freshness. Additionally, the entire dish can be assembled in the slow cooker the night before, allowing the flavors to meld even more. Just cover it and refrigerate, then cook it straight from the fridge following the regular instructions. To ensure the chicken remains tender and delicious, avoid overcooking it, and adjust the cooking time based on whether you’re using fresh or frozen ingredients.
